In 2019-2020, 3,114 people earned their degree in community organization and advocacy, making the major the 243rd most popular in the United States.
Across the New England region, there were 280 community organization and advocacy gra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 200 community organization and advocacy graduates with average earnings and debt of $41,041 and $24,492 respectively.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Providence College. It ranked #2 on our 2022 Best Value Community Organization Schools for a Bachelor’s in the New England Region For Those Making $0-$30k list. This small school is located in Providence, Rhode Island, and it awarded 12 bachelors’s community organization degrees in 2019-2020.
Providence also made our “Best Community Organization & Advocacy Bachelor’s Degree Schools in the New England Region” list, coming in at #2. The estimated yearly cost for Providence College is $19,328 for New England Region Bachelor’s Degree Community Organization students whose families make $0-$30k.
The low student loan default rate of 2.3%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%. With a freshman retention rate of 92%, the school does an excellent job of retaining its students.
